Jesse Eisenberg Is Still Up for Playing Lex Luthor Again for DC

I personally wasn’t sold on Jesse Eisenberg’s take on Lex Luthor in the DCEU. I think he’s a solid actor, but seeing him in the role of Lex never clicked with me. I know a lot of fans that do think he was great in the role, though, and if you liked how he handled the character, you’ll be happy to know that he would love the opportunity to play Lex again.

The character’s return was set up in the post-credits scene of Justice League, but Warner Bros. is pretty much acting like that movie doesn’t exist. They’d certainly like to forget about it! So, I seriously doubt we’ll see any threads from that story continue in the future. Things didn’t really go as planned and the studio is distancing itself from Zack Snyder’s DC films.

It’s likely that Henry Cavill will never return as the Man of Steel as much as the actor wants to, which means Eisenberg’s return as Lex is also a long shot. But, if the studio does want to revisit the character, Eisenberg is totally up for it! During a recent interview, the actor was asked if he would play the character again and this was his response:

"Oh yeah, I would love to because it’s such a cool character. To play a villain in a superhero movie is the fun part. The good guys are fine but the villain is the fun part cause you get to be more flamboyant. The hero usually gets to survive but the villain has all the funny lines."
